NEW ARCHBISHOP

CAPETOWN DIOCESE [fbom txm OWN correspondent] CAPETOWN. June 1 The Right Rev. John Russell Darbyshire, Lord Bishop of Glasgow and Galloway, has been elected Archbishop of Capetown, in succession to Dr. Phelps. Dr. Darbyshire thus bocomes head of the Anglican Church in South Africa. The new archbishop was born in 1880 and educated at Dulwich College and at Emmanuel College, Cambridge, where he had a brilliant career as a classical and theological scholar. He has been Canon Residentiary of Manchester Cathedral and Vicar of Sheffield, and was consecrated Bishop of Glasgow in 1931.
